Position in the US media landscape
News Corp operates a diversified media portfolio including news publishing, pay-TV and digital real estate services, which puts it in direct comparison with integrated groups like Disney and Paramount. The Class B shares represent voting stock, giving investors governance exposure alongside financial performance.
While Disney is driven strongly by its streaming platform Disney+ and theme parks, and Paramount by Paramount+ and its film studio, News Corp's mix is more weighted toward news, sports and property listings. This different composition influences how analysts assess the resilience of its earnings across cycles.
Analyst focus on earnings mix
Analysts regularly highlight that News Corp's earnings depend significantly on advertising, subscription revenues and digital real estate, rather than purely on streaming growth. This can make the shares behave differently from pure-play streaming peers when advertising markets or housing markets move.
For investors, the comparison to Disney and Paramount therefore includes not only headline revenue growth but also the stability of cash flows from subscription media and digital platforms. The Class B shares serve as a central instrument for participating in this diversified earnings base.

How News Corp makes money
News Corp generates revenue primarily from its news and information services, pay-TV networks and digital real estate platforms like REA Group and Realtor.com. These businesses combine subscription income, advertising sales and transaction-related fees for property listings.
